Welcome to DSMStyle though, just read around on the board and you'll be able to learn a lot fairly quickly. If you are interested in making your car quick and not selling it for a turbo model, there are a few decent turbo-kit options available for your car including the Hahn and Star brands. Be sure to get aftermarket shocks with your lowering springs otherwise your car will ride awful and handle worse than stock. Camber kits will also be required to keep your alignment within spec. Are you dropping your car for handling/performance reasons or just for asthetics?
